2. Do you have any other spaces to shoot content?

If you didn’t know about our wellness room – you do now.

Native Wellness has quickly become a member favourite. Wellness room access is now included in our memberships, and we’ve also opened it up for content shoots too. It’s a simple, elegant backdrop that suits a lot of different content.

The Native Space wellness room

Room hire from £36/hr – the space on its own, yours to shoot however you like. Additional lighting is available as an extra.

Wellness instructor shoots from £90/hr – this includes the room and the filming of all content – so you leave with all footage ready to edit. Reel edits cost extra.

We’ve had a range of content shot in here over the past few months: wellness shoots, photoshoots using backdrops, and members bringing in their own clients to shoot for socials.

3. Can I customise my office or suite – or expand into a bigger one?

Yes to both, and that’s exactly what the model is designed for.

On customising: plenty of members have completely reshaped their spaces. What was once an empty warehouse suite is now a pink laser clinic; and another one of our offices upstairs has been transformed into an aesthetics practice. If you have an idea for your space, come and talk to us about it.

Empty warehouse suite before customisation Laser clinic after customisation

On expanding: when members come and talk to us about a bigger space, it usually means their business is growing – which is exactly what we want – so we’ll do everything we can to make it work. We’ve had members asking about taking down walls to turn two units into one, and one member has just taken an office upstairs alongside their suite. If you need more room, there’s usually a solution – the earlier you tell us, the more options we have.

4. Can I host my own events here?

Absolutely – that’s why we have the lounge and kitchen area. We’ve hosted many events including: wellness evenings, women in business events, and of course Native Space’s very own First Friday.

The bi-fold doors open the meeting room out into the lounge – which makes it a flexible space for anything from a launch night to a networking morning.

Members get exclusive rates on hiring the space.
